The Sphinx's Secret Quest

Lily was the best backyard spy in all of Maple Street. Every morning, she put on her detective hat and grabbed her magnifying glass. Her faithful dog, Barnaby, always trotted beside her, his golden tail wagging like a metronome.

One sunny afternoon, Lily discovered something extraordinary behind the old oak tree. A tiny sphinx sat perched on a mushroom, no bigger than her thumb! The sphinx had emerald eyes and wings like a hummingbird.

"I've been waiting for you, Spy Girl," the sphinx chimed. "My name is Zephyr, and I need your help. The enchanted goldfish in the pond has lost her sparkle, and only you can save her!"

Lily's eyes widened with wonder. She scooped up Zephyr, and together with Barnaby, they raced to the pond. There, floating sadly among the lily pads, was Glitter the goldfish. Her scales, once shimmering like rainbows, had turned dull as gray stones.

"What happened?" Lily asked gently.

"She forgot her morning sunshine vitamin!" Zephyr explained. "In the magical realm, fish need to catch three sunbeams every day to stay sparkly. Glitter has been hiding in the shadows because she's shy."

Lily knelt by the water's edge. "Glitter, don't be afraid. Barnaby and I will be your friends. We'll help you catch the sunbeams!"

For three days, Lily brought Glitter to the surface at dawn. Barnaby barked happily, creating ripples that danced with light. Zephyr flew above, catching sunbeams in his wings and sprinkling them like confetti.

By the fourth morning, Glitter's scales shimmered brighter than ever. She did a joyful flip, creating a splash of rainbow droplets.

"Thank you, my friends!" Glitter bubbled. "I learned that being brave means asking for help. And true friends always help each other shine."

Zephyr handed Lily a tiny crystal heart. "Keep this, Spy Girl. Whenever you need courage, hold it tight and remember: you're never alone when you have friends."

That night, Lily put the crystal heart under her pillow. She drifted to sleep dreaming of sphinxes, goldfish, and magical adventures, knowing that the best spies don't just solve mysteries—they make friends along the way.
